A leading firm in financial services is seeking a Credit Controller for a 12-month fixed-term contract. The role involves managing invoicing collections, handling queries, and using the Xero system.
Candidates should demonstrate strong credit control and analytical skills coupled with proficient Excel capabilities. This is a hybrid position requiring 1-2 days in the office, with a salary of £30,000-35,000 per annum, depending on experience.

How to prepare for a job interview at Helix International Group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
Brush up on your credit control metrics and be ready to discuss how you've managed invoicing collections in the past. Being able to cite specific examples will show that you understand the financial landscape and can handle the responsibilities of the role.
✨Familiarise Yourself with Xero
Since the job involves using the Xero system, make sure you have a basic understanding of it. If you’ve used similar software, mention that experience and express your willingness to learn quickly. This will demonstrate your adaptability and eagerness to hit the ground running.
✨Excel Skills are Key
Prepare to showcase your Excel capabilities. Think about how you've used Excel for data analysis or reporting in previous roles. Bring examples of spreadsheets or reports you've created, as this will highlight your analytical skills and attention to detail.
✨Hybrid Work Mindset
Since this is a hybrid position, be ready to discuss how you manage your time and productivity when working remotely. Share strategies that have worked for you in the past, as this will reassure them that you can thrive in both office and home environments.
